728x90
AmazoneS3FullAccess
-
aws ecs s3 access deniedAWS 2022. 2. 27. 12:27
문제 ECS에 도커 컨테이너(spring boot) 이용해 REST API 개발중 S3 Access denied 에러를 발견 하였다. API 통해 유저 이미지 등을 s3 private bucket 에 올려야 하는 요구사항이었고 기존에 ec2에서는 ec2 IAM role에 s3FullAccess 등을 주어 개발에 무리가 없었다. 하지만 ecs2InstanceRole에 s3FullAccess 를 주었음에도 s3 access denied 에러가 해결이 되질 않았다. 해결 먼저 AWS IAM ec2InstanceRole에 s3FullAccess가 있음을 확인했다. -> API는 여전히 access denied를 반환 이 문제를 해결하기위해 많은 방법을 시도햇지만 결국 아래와 같은 방법으로 해결하였음 ecsIns..